Output d59e74930913668b8c13c17c5a28791f698ea2a67a25c8a75c62f4bce4fcbec1:0

value
2717449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6500ce3f2b57a045849ff1f391694a496dd7c95f OP_EQUAL
address
3Au58twHtpyXDkqivfv7uGcnSh57h6TW4Y
transaction
d59e74930913668b8c13c17c5a28791f698ea2a67a25c8a75c62f4bce4fcbec1
spent
true